22.02.2010 EnzymeRx Provides a
Clinical Update on Pegsitacase
EnzymeRx, LLC,
a clinical-stage biotechnology company, today announced completion
of the enrollment of its first clinical trial of pegsitacase
(formerly called Uricase PEG 20), and the recent launch of a second
clinical study. Pegsitacase is a pegylated uricase being
developed by EnzymeRx for the treatment of refractory gout and for
the management of hyperuricemia associated with tumor lysis
syndrome.

19.02.2010 FDA Classifies Prolia(TM)
(Denosumab) Complete Response Submission and Targets Action Date
Amgen Inc.
(Nasdaq: AMGN) today announced that the U.S. Food and Drug
Administration (FDA) has evaluated the content of the Company's
Complete Response submission for Prolia(TM) (denosumab)
in the treatment of postmenopausal osteoporosis and classified it as
a Class 2 resubmission. With the Class 2 designation, the FDA set a
corresponding Prescription Drug User Fee Act (PDUFA) action date of
July 25, 2010. |

19.02.2010
FDA Approves
Rituxan Plus Chemotherapy for the Most Common Type
of Adult Leukemia
Genentech, Inc., a
wholly owned member of the Roche Group
(SIX: RO, ROG; OTCQX: RHHBY), and Biogen
Idec (Nasdaq: BIIB) announced today the
U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A)
approved RituxanŽ (rituximab) in
combination with fludarabine and
cyclophosphamide (FC) for people with
previously untreated and previously
treated CD20-positive chronic
lymphocytic leukemia (CLL).

17.02.2010
Abbott Completes Acquisition of
Solvay Pharmaceuticals
Abbott
today announced that it has completed its
EUR 4.5 billion ($6.2 billion) acquisition of
Belgium-based Solvay Pharmaceuticals, providing Abbott
with a large and complementary portfolio of
pharmaceutical products and expanding Abbott's presence
in key global emerging markets.
